XYLD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2015 in Review

12 of the 3,711 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Global X S&P 500 Covered Call ETF (XYLD) for Q2 2015, worth a combined $5.71M — down 23% from $7.44M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 2 funds closed out of XYLD and 0 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 5 trimmed existing stakes and 4 added.

The largest buyer was UBS Group, adding an estimated $129K. The largest seller was Virtu KCG Holdings, cutting an estimated $739K.
